Custard vs. Summer squash — In-Depth Nutrition Comparison
Compare
Differences between custard and summer squash
- Custard is higher in vitamin B12, phosphorus, calcium, vitamin B5, selenium, and vitamin D; however, summer squash is richer in vitamin C and vitamin B6.
- Custard's daily need coverage for vitamin B12 is 22% higher.
- Summer squash has a lower glycemic index (13) than custard (35).
The food types used in this comparison are Egg custards, dry mix, prepared with whole milk and Squash, summer, all varieties, raw.
